COVID-19: First Tokyo Olympics event postponed in Japan

Webdunia
Thursday, 28 January 2021 (16:11 IST)
The first event of the Tokyo Olympics has been postponed because of travel restrictions in Japan, the event’s organizers said on Thursday. Japan is currently in a state of emergency until at least February 7 following rising cases of the coronavirus.

The artistic swimming event was scheduled to take place from March 4-7 in Tokyo, but is now postponed to May. The organizers said the decision was taken to ensure the “fairest possible conditions for athletes to participate.”

They added that other qualifying events such as a Diving World Cup in April and marathon swimming in May were on schedule. Public support for the Olympics is low, with 80% of Japanese saying they either thought the Games would not or should not go ahead as currently planned in a recent poll.
